In many German forest soils low base saturation of CEC in deeper soil layers was reported and acidic deposition is seen as
the major cause of these findings. To test this hypothesis we sampled 5 New Zealand forest soils from pristine beech (Nothofagus fusca, N. menziesii, N. solandri) sites under climatic and geological conditions comparable to higher elevations in Germany. The soils developed from granite
and greywacke. Soil samples were analyzed for pH and the exchangeable cations were extracted with 1M NH4Cl. The base saturation of all soil profiles was very low, even in deeper layers and was thus similar to the patterns found
in many German forest soils. The pH was generally higher in the New Zealand soils as compared to Germany. The reason for the
depletion of base cations in deeper soil layers of New Zealand forest soils is most likely the leaching of base cations with
HCO3
- resulting from the dissociation of carbonic acid in connection with high amounts of seepage. Thus, under high rainfall conditions,
the low base saturation found in deeper layers of forest soils cannot exclusively be attributed to the effects of acidic depositions
and land use. ei]Section editor: R F Huettl 相似文献

Mike H. Jurke 《Primates; journal of primatology》1996,37(1):109-119
The fate of most nonhuman primate species is intimately related to man. The increasing encroachment on the natural habitat
has resulted in the decimation and even near extinction of some species. Along with this development, the basic concept in
many modern zoos has changed from one of merely display to self-perpetuating units. Primate research facilities are orienting
their research programs towards reproductive physiology and behavior in an effort to provide basic knowledge of reproduction
in these species. This increased emphasis in the area of reproductive biology and the various efforts to improve breeding
of these mostly endangered primates in captivity has stimulated the author to write this review. It represents an attempt
to provide the reader with basic background information relating to the endocrinology and behavior of reproduction in the
clawed New World monkeys as it exists at the time of publication.
The intermediate evolutionary position ofCallimico goeldii between the clawed New World monkeys and the ‘true New World monkeys’ and our relatively poor knowledge about reproduction
and behavior in this particular species fully justifies the focus on Goeldi’s monkey in this essay. This review is an attempt
to provide a brief history of previous studies but also the basis for research in the future. The current status of knowledge
of the small-bodied clawed monkeys is also discussed in an evolutionary context, with an emphasis on the different reproductive
strategies in this dynamic group of primates.
The outcome, not surprisingly, confirms the unique position ofCallimico goeldii in its social, ecological, and evolutionary environment. 相似文献

The distribution of the New Zealand flatworm (Artioposthia triangulata) in Scotland was surveyed between July 1991 and February 1993. There were 348 records from domestic gardens, 56 from botanic gardens, garden centres and nurseries, with only 13 from farms. Although most of the records came from around the major cities the flatworm was found to have become established throughout the Scottish mainland and some of the Islands, e.g. Bute, Gigha, Orkney and Skye. The impact of the flatworm on earthworm populations in agricultural land in Scotland was, as yet, found to be minimal but the fact that seven adjacent farms near Dunoon were infected suggested it could be spread from farm to farm and that in the West of Scotland it could become widespread in agricultural land. 相似文献

Parasites of all kinds affect the behaviour of their hosts, often making them more susceptible to predators. The associated
loss in expected future reproductive success of infected hosts will vary among individuals, with younger ones having more
lose than older ones. For this reason, young hosts would benefit more by opposing the effects of parasites than old ones.
In a laboratory study, the effects of the trematode Telogaster opisthorchis on the anti-predator responses of the upland bully (Gobiomorphus breviceps) and of the common river galaxias (Galaxias vulgaris) were examined in relation to fish age. In a bully population where parasites were very abundant, the magnitude of the fish's
anti-predator responses decreased as the number of parasites per fish increased, and this effect was significantly more pronounced
in age 2 + and, to a lesser extent, age 3 + fish than in age 1 + fish. In another bully population where parasites were 10
times less abundant, similar effects were noticeable but not significant, whereas no effects of parasites on the responses
of galaxiids to predators were apparent. Differences in the abundance of parasites and in their sites of infection in fish
may explain the variability among host populations or species. However, in the bully population with high parasite abundance,
parasitism has age-dependent effects on responses to predators, providing some support for the prediction that young fish
with high expected future reproductive success invest more energy into opposing the effects of parasites than do older fish. 相似文献

Randall W. Myster 《Plant Ecology》1994,114(2):169-174
Because the fate of seeds is critical to understanding the invasion of old fields by trees, and plant litter is an important component defining the old field microsite of dispersed seeds, I investigated the effects of litter type (Solidago spp./goldenrod,Quercus spp./oak, mixed) and litter amount (100–800 g/m2) on tree seed germination and seedling emergence. I found that at all densities bothSolidago andQuercus litter greatly reduced emergence of the small-seeded, bird-dispersed species,Juniperus virginiana andCornus florida. For one of the large-seeded, mammal-dispersed species,Carya tomentosa, high densitySolidago litter and high density mixed litter treatments reduced emergence. For the other large-seeded species,Quercus rubra, the high density mixed litter treatment and all levels ofSolidago litter reduced emergence.Quercus seedlings emerged twice as often as the other three species in control pots without litter.Carya emerged before the other species but the high density oak treatment delayed the expansion of its cotyledons. My results suggest that litter may contribute to the slow rate of tree invasion and the low probability of tree establishment in old fields. However, old field litter studies taken together point to the difficulty in drawing general conclusions about any net effect of litter on old field tree establishment. 相似文献
